Aung San Suu Kyi waits near Yangon, Myanmar, to learn whether she will serve five years in prison for violating her house arrest, Myanmar officials said. Testimony in Suu Kyi's trial ended July 10 and a verdict is expected soon, The New York Times reported.

focus on saving lives UN chief Ban Ki-moon began a mission on Wednesday for Myanmar's cyclone victims, saying "our focus now is on saving lives," as the military government gave approval for the first foreign helicopters to distribute aid.
